
Nigerian government announces N100,000 as new passport fees
The Nigerian government has announced an upward review of Nigerian Standard Passport fees with effect from September 1, 2025, while the latest upward review in passport cost is coming a year after the government implemented a similar policy.
Penpushing reports that Nigeria Immigration Service (NIS) Public Relations Officer, Akinsola Akinlabi made this development known in a statement on Thursday in Abuja, Federal Capital Territory (FCT)

The service spokesperson said that the review was to uphold the quality and integrity of the Nigerian passport, adding that with the new rates, applications made in Nigeria will now cost N100,000 for a 32-page booklet with five-year validity.
‘Applications made in Nigeria for a 64-page booklet with 10 years validity will cost N200, 000. Applications made by Nigerians in the diaspora remain $150 for a 32-page booklet with five-year validity and $230 for a 64-page booklet with 10-year validity’, he said
Penpushing further reports that Akinlabi in the statement reiterated the commitment of the service to balancing quality service delivery with accessibility of passport services to all Nigerians.
The Nigerian government it would be recalled that had on August 21, 2024 approved an increase in passport fees in what it described as part of its efforts to maintain the quality and integrity of the Nigerian passport system, the policy which took effect on September 1, 2024.

Penpushing also reports that Kenneth Udo, who was spokesperson of the service at the time announced, explained that based on the review, 32-page passport booklet with five-year validity previously charged at N35,000 would now be N50,000 only.
“Based on the review, 32-page passport booklet with five-year validity previously charged at N35,000 would now be N50,000 only. The 64-page Passport booklet with 10-year validity which was N70,000 would be N100,000 only’, he had said
